About 2500 Enfield Rd

Be the first to live in this 100% NEWLY REMODELED 2BR 1.5 BA townhouse in the coveted Enfield neighborhood. This must see, just completed, stylish, modern, natural lit home starts with the grand living room with cathedral ceiling, stone fireplace and two south facing windows. Move forward over the classy flooring to the dining room and then onward to the stylish kitchen with quartz counters, soft close cabinet doors, and stainless steel appliances including a cooktop exhaust that discharges to the exterior. Off the kitchen sits a back door as well as the laundry room with new washer and dryer along with storage cabinets above. Nearby, is the downstairs half bath, coat closet and under stair storage room. Follow the new wood stairs to the the 2nd floor to two well-lit bedrooms with ceiling fans and large closets. Rounding out the second floor is a luxurious new bathroom with large shower and modern sliding glass door. Easy access southward to the new HEB, Deep Eddy Pool, various restaurants, and the ladybird Lake greenway, westward to Lake Austin's restaurant row, and eastward to downtown, UT, Barton Springs, live music and all that Austin has to offer. Unit also comes with 2 reserved parking spaces right in front. Water, sewer and trash are included. Enjoy this cozy, clean and modern home for years to come! Available now. Will go fast.

Marc Richmond spent his childhood years in Germany, Maryland and Pennsylvania, then his early career in Pennsylvania, Colorado, and California, but has been a proud Austin resident since 1996. He brings 30 years of unique experience as a builder, consultant, trainer and realtor. Marc started his construction career in Pennsylvania fresh out of college working in most of the trades including carpentry, electrical, tile/marble, and architectural woodworking. His green building career began in Los Angeles in 1993, then moved on to Colorado, and then eventually settled in Austin to build green homes and then to join the City of Austin's Green Building Program from 1997 to 2004, as a residential specialist and manager of the program. Marc is also responsible for guiding the development of California’s residential green building program, Build It Green, which has trained thousands of builders, architects, engineers, and realtors, set the de-facto residential standards for green building in California, and certified over 125,000 green homes. He is a nationally known expert in the green building field, and has written numerous articles and made significant contributions to numerous reference books in the field. Marc graduated with a BA in Economics from Moravian College in Pennsylvania, and MBA in International Business and an MAPP in Energy & Environmental Policy from Claremont Graduate University in Southern California. Some of Marc’s professional certifications include: LEED AP (1998), CGBP (2004), GPR (2007), Cal-HERS (2008), BPI-MF (2010), NAR-GREEN (2015), and NAR-GRI (2016). He was the first co-chair of the USGBC LEED Residential Committee from 1998-2000 and served on various technical subcommittees for LEED Commercial. While working as a REALTOR® in Austin, Marc continues consult with and train a wide range of REALTORS® and building professionals locally and throughout the nation. He is the sole trainer for Build It Green’s CGBP and GPR designations throughout California and is one of a small handful of trainers certified to teach the National Association of REALTORS® GREEN Designation course throughout the country.
